TF13 6DE is a mixed residential area located 0.5km from Westwood, Stretton in Shropshire. Administratively it sits within Much Wenlock ward and the Ludlow constituency.

For renters and young professionals, TF13 6DE offers a spacious suburb popular with older working households approaching retirement. The daytime character shifts — mainly white older workforce, self-employed in agriculture, forestry and fishing, with some construction. The 43 average age reflects a mixed, mid-career community — settling down but not yet slowing down. 42% of homes are privately rented — a strong rental market with good supply for incoming tenants.

Property: Average house prices are around £260k.

Census 2021 statistics for TF13 6DE are sourced from Output Area E00146948 (shared with 23 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
